Curtis Yarvin / Mencius Moldbug
Essential Works (Blog Essays):
- A Gentle Introduction to Unqualified Reservations – His manifesto
- An Open Letter to Open-Minded Progressives – Critique of the Cathedral
- How Dawkins Got Pwned – Memetics and ideology
- Patchwork – Political theory of decentralized sovereignty
Key Ideas:
- The Cathedral – Progressive ideology as quasi-religious orthodoxy enforced by media, academia, and bureaucracy
- Democracy as failed operating system – Needs to be replaced with CEO-style governance (not elected leaders)
- Neocameralism – Sovereign corporations competing for citizens
- Formalism – Make power structures explicit rather than hidden
- Exit over voice – Leave bad systems rather than trying to reform them
Why Essential: Yarvin updates reactionary monarchism for the digital age. He's controversial and deliberately provocative, but intellectually rigorous.
Nick Land
Accelerationist/Cybergothic Reactionary
Essential Works:
- The Dark Enlightenment (essay) – Neoreactionary manifesto
- Fanged Noumena – Collected philosophical writings
- Meltdown – Accelerationism and techno-capital singularity
Key Ideas:
- HBD (Human Biodiversity) – Genetic differences matter
- Gnon (Nature or Nature's God) – Reality has its own harsh logic that democracy denies
- Accelerationism – Speed up capitalism and technology to their conclusion
- Exit – Seasteading, charter cities, secession from failed states
